Dino-Lite Am2111-Ms22B - 10X-50X, 230X - 640X480 Pixels - Handheld Digital Usb Microscope, Integrated 4 Led Illumination - Gooseneck Stand
The Dino-Lite entry-level AM2111 handheld digital microscope is packaged here with the popular MS22B gooseneck stand The AM2111 is best in class among the sub $100 handheld digital microscopes with better optics, construction and software It offers a stronger housing with magnification scroll lock, 640x480 pixel accurate color resolution, sophisticated but simple to use included software for both Pc and Mac and 4 white LED lights that are always on Recommended for schools and hobbyists, the AM2111 also provides variable magnification of 10x50x and up to 230x Simply position the microscope at the required distance and focus by using the scroll bar on the side of the microscope housing Then take stills, live video or even time lapse video, all of which can be neatly stored in a variety of popular formats (JPEg, BMP, AVI) in the included file management system Powered by USB 20, the microscope is housed in a tough ABS plastic shell The MS21W is by far the most popular, general purpose Dino-Lite microscope stand It is an articulating stand with 30cm flexible gooseneck and included white holster Simply bend the gooseneck to the required angle or position The overall dimensions measure 84 x70 x 23 Includes digital microscope, MS21W stand, cradle stand, software cD
